This just happened to me. 2001 ml320, 38k miles. dealer said I got some bad gas and the fuel line was flushed. The diagnostics plus the cleaning was $400. Then is started happening a week later - worse. Check engine light on, running very rough, pressing gas pedal to floor - not getting acceleration. Dealer then said some of the cylinders were gone and replaced the wiring, etc... another $500. Runs perfectly now.

I have had this problem with my 99 ML320 for six months. The problem is, everyone wants to fix it differently. One shop wanted to replace the ignition cables. Another wanted to replace the o2 sensor (these have never worked for long). Mt "check engine"light has been on for seven years. My oil light has been on for two years. The dealership told me to buy a new car six months ago... that it wouldn't run another week. I put 15,000 miles on it since then (currently at 215,000).

The fuel injector comment makes sense - especially since restarting the engine makes the problem go away. If anyone has any other thoughts I would appreciate hearing them.

PS - I am told every week that I purchased the worst Mercedes ever built. Have any of you heard this? The problems have been a pain, but 215,000 miles for $39k isn't bad.

How much should it cost to replace a bad fuel injector?

I have a similar misfire lost of power problem with my ML320-1999 but no check engine light. It happened 4 times over the past 8 months but last month I have the same problem almost every morning, motor runing on 4-5 cilinders during warm up and I have to turn engine off and on again to solve problem.  Yesterday, I added a Fuel injector cleaner Gumout and today verything is normal.  Do you think that a professional injector cleaning will solve problem? Do you recommend to replace all fuel injectors? Is there a problem in to use Gumout for 2 -3 tanks to try to clean injectors?
